June 30, 2022 @ 1:52pmTwo of the most predominant factions of Star Wars storytelling, the Jedi and the Sith are featured in a new collection of ten original tales. Stories of Jedi and Sith—very much like its inherent predecessor, The Clone Wars: Stories of Light and Dark—showcases some of the most popular characters of the franchise, from Obi-Wan Kenobi and Anakin Skywalker to Darth Maul and Emperor Palpatine. In this anthology, we have a stellar roster of new and veteran Star Wars authors alongside a gorgeous cover and interior spot artwork by Jake Bartok, a combination that makes Stories of Jedi and Sith the perfect collectible for the fans’ bookshelves.
Each tale within Stories of Jedi and Sith dives into the characterization of a featured hero or villain, sometimes in and sometimes out of the character’s perspective—spanning from the High Republic era all the way to the sequel trilogy. Although they don’t really impact the canon timeline at all, the stories provide a good amount of character development, especially when it comes to dealing with ghosts of the past or what it means to be a Jedi or Sith. However, some readers might argue that most of these stories might feel a bit inconclusive—each ending not as satisfying as you would hope. This is probably due to the nature of the Star Wars storyline reserving these crucial characters for larger stories within the canon timeline.
Having said that, Stories of Jedi and Sith contain some really fun stories, including What a Jedi Makes, an unexpected tale of a young boy who desperately wants to join the Jedi Order during the High Republic era, by author Michael Kogge; Worthless, by Delilah S. Dawson, featuring everyone’s favorite assassin of the Sith, Asajj Ventress being forced to work with a clone trooper for survival; and The Ghosts of Maul, by Michael Moreci, a story of Maul entering a mysterious Sith castle that could easily enter the Star Wars horror hall of fame.
Stories of Jedi and Sith is yet another celebration of everyone’s favorite heroes and villains, and the physical book (especially the Star Wars Celebration Anaheim 2022 special edition) is an absolute must for book collectors.
